暂无图片
暂无图片
暂无图片
暂无图片
暂无图片

查询工具中使用自动补全功能

原创 2022-08-12
3248

Table of Contents

1.查询工具中如何使用自动补全功能

在查询中,你开始打字时,就可以使用自动补全功能。在编译器中,使用 Control + Space (ctrl + 空格)组合键,自动补全功能会给出"对象名称"或者是"执行命令"的单词。比如:在输入 select * from 后面加一个空格,然后使用 Control + space (ctrl + 空格)组合键,就会弹出一个菜单选项,然后选中需要的,就完成了自动补全。

2.关键字的自动补全

对于关键字,只需输入几个字符然后按下 Control + Space 组合键。
image.png

3.schema 或者 schema对象的自动补全

schema 和 schema 对象中使用,输入 schema 名称和符号 (点)"." 然后使用ctrl +空格 组合键。
image.png

image.png

4.在查询工具中设置搜索路径

在前面的例子和截图中,只有输入 schema 名称和 "."后,才能看到 ’ test_schema_diff ’ 的对象。用户可以设置搜索路径,然后尝试相同的 “SELECT” 查询。设置搜索路径后,您将看到 ’ test_schema_diff ’ 的所有对象。

image.png

5.连接语句的自动补全

使用连接语句查询,并按下Control + Space组合键。
image.png

6.用于实现自动补全的第三方代码

pgAdmin 4 使用来自 https://www.pgcli.com/ 的代码,并根据需要稍加修改即可工作。
Pgcli 使用prompt_toolkit, pgAdmin 4将此代码与code Mirror库集成以实现自动补全。

7.结论

通过减少输入工作并提供对数据库对象信息的快速访问,使用自动补全特性可以更快地编写SQL命令。

原文标题:How To Use Autocomplete Feature in Query Tool
原文作者:Akshay Joshi
原文地址:https://www.enterprisedb.com/blog/autocomplete-feature-query-tool

「喜欢这篇文章,您的关注和赞赏是给作者最好的鼓励」
关注作者
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文章的来源(墨天轮),文章链接,文章作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论

目录
  • 1.查询工具中如何使用自动补全功能
  • 2.关键字的自动补全
  • 3.schema 或者 schema对象的自动补全
  • 4.在查询工具中设置搜索路径
  • 5.连接语句的自动补全
  • 6.用于实现自动补全的第三方代码
  • 7.结论